trial. Welcome to the Corporate Casket, a weekly series where bad
businesses go to die. Focus on the Family seems to have the
recipe for hated turned political. They get a boatload of money
from their media appearances, twist research to support their
crusade against lgbtq+ people, and have their own political
organization that teaches people how to vote. The new leader says
it will get less harmful as their speech continues to spread across
the world. But, with the founder, James Dobson’s horrific
viewpoints steeped deeply into the organization, and their
continued use of conversion therapy, this doesn’t seem very
likely. Connect With Me: https://linktr.ee/iilluminaughtii’
